Transaction 37591d33d298f644a72ee71714bdf341bdac862df1e2e46953e979e9738dce62

1 Input
2 Outputs
  • 37591d33d298f644a72ee71714bdf341bdac862df1e2e46953e979e9738dce62:0
  • value  728590287
    address  17DwZ8gVBwsut2feiVTEVD3Dv3z58vkmVE
  • 37591d33d298f644a72ee71714bdf341bdac862df1e2e46953e979e9738dce62:1
  • value  18545260
    address  194MbfiQkxhZuWqBswRA46QKYCb2Xyvzcc